Erreur fréquente :
Learners sometimes confuse 'sustain' with 'retain'; 'retain' means to keep possession, while 'sustain' means to keep something going.

VERBE C1 FORMAL
4
Schéma d’usage :
to sustain [an objection/appeal/decision]
The judge sustained the objection from the defense attorney.
A bíró helyt adott a védőügyvéd kifogásának.
The court sustained his appeal against the fine.
A bíróság helyt adott a bírság elleni fellebbezésének.
Her claim was sustained by the committee after review.
Exemples pédagogiques
The judge sustained the lawyer's objection.
A bíró helyt adott az ügyvéd kifogásának.
The court sustained his request.
A bíróság helyt adott a kérelmének.
The claim was sustained by the board.
Sens
Uphold a decision or ruling
Collocations
sustain an objection |sustain an appeal
Synonymes
uphold ('Uphold' is more common outside courtrooms; 'sustain' is often used in legal rulings.)
Antonymes
overrule (Means to reject a decision or objection that was made earlier.)
Thèmes
law |politics
Définition

To say officially that a rule, decision, or claim is correct and will stand.

To decide officially that a claim, objection, or decision is valid and will be accepted.
